August and September is dry season in the Western Cape. It’s the best weather window of the year. Table Mountain is clear, the Winelands are post-harvest and beautiful, and the whale watching season along the Garden Route is at its peak. Humpback and southern right whales come in close to shore in August and September specifically. It’s worth timing a coastal day around.

Cape Town is also one of the few African cities genuinely easy to navigate independently. No complicated logistics, excellent infrastructure, and enough to fill two weeks without leaving the province.
